nx_js_gc_gate.nx -- prove the non-moving mark-sweep collector (conservative word-scan made EXACT by the block-start bitmap). Under a TINY 64KB threshold (a collection fires ~every 500 objects): (A) RECLAIM -- 100k garbage objects leave resident memory BOUNDED (nx_pool_hp plateaus; collections fire). (B) RETAIN -- large structures kept live across many collections SURVIVE intact (missing root=crash/wrong). (C) EXACT -- every result stays V8-exact under aggressive GC, incl the 6 self-validating Octane benches. Any missing root manifests as a use-after-free the self-checking programs catch. expect_exit: 0 license_tier: ORIGINAL NOTE: helpers take <=2 data args -- nx_cc miscompiled a 3-arg helper call here (crash before/at the callee), so `want` is threaded through a module global instead of a 3rd parameter.
